Is Butter Pecan Vanilla Flavor and Real Pecan Pieces Frozen Dairy Dessert good for weight loss?

At 170 calories per serving with 14g of sugar and only 3g of protein, this frozen dessert isn't ideal for weight loss efforts. The high sugar content relative to protein means it won't keep you satisfied for long, making it easy to overconsume.

Is Butter Pecan Vanilla Flavor and Real Pecan Pieces Frozen Dairy Dessert suitable for people with lactose intolerance?

This product contains lactase enzyme, which helps break down some lactose, but it still includes cream and whey. People with severe lactose intolerance should avoid it, though those with mild sensitivity might tolerate it better than regular ice cream.

Is Butter Pecan Vanilla Flavor and Real Pecan Pieces Frozen Dairy Dessert gluten-free?

Yes, this frozen dessert appears to be gluten-free based on the ingredient list, which contains no gluten-containing grains or standard gluten sources.

What diets does Butter Pecan Vanilla Flavor and Real Pecan Pieces Frozen Dairy Dessert suit?

This works best as an occasional treat within flexible diets rather than a diet staple. Its high sugar content makes it less suitable for low-carb, keto, or strict diabetes-management diets, though the presence of pecans and moderate calories might allow small portions in some balanced approaches.

What should I watch out for with Butter Pecan Vanilla Flavor and Real Pecan Pieces Frozen Dairy Dessert?

The sugar content at 14g per 85g serving is substantial—that's more than a third of a typical daily limit in a small portion. Additionally, while lactase enzyme is included to break down lactose, the presence of cream and whey means it's not entirely lactose-free, so sensitive individuals should be cautious.
